About BRILLIANT CRESYL BLUE SOLUTION (ALCOHOLIC)



Brilliant Cresyl Blue Solution (Alcoholic) is a laboratory-grade chemical reagent used in staining reticulocytes in blood smear analysis and other biological applications. This liquid solution, with an alcoholic odor, is stored in a cool, dry place away from ignition sources. With a pH level ranging from 6 to 8, it is an analytical standard primarily used for staining in microbiology and histology. Its purity varies according to lab standards, and it is classified under HS Code 3822.00.90 as an alcoholic Brilliant Cresyl Blue solution, mainly composed of Brilliant Cresyl Blue.
